Baird, Callahan County, Texas Property Taxes
Property Taxes in Baird, Texas
Median Baird, Texas effective property tax rate: 1.50%, significantly higher than the national median of 1.02%, and higher than the Texas state median of 1.48%.
Median Baird, Texas home value: $95,375
Median annual Baird, Texas tax bill: $1,311, lower than the national median property tax bill of $2,400.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Baird, Callahan County, Texas
When examining property taxes in Baird, Texas,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ial.
The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The Callahan County appraisal district estimates the market value for tax purposes.
The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.
Assessment notices:
In Callahan County, assessment notices are sent in April each year.
Each property owner receives an assessment notice that contains both the market value and assessed value, along with an estimate of your property tax bill. For Baird, the median home price is $95,375, with a median tax bill of $1,311. The highest median home price is in 79504 at $95,375.

Property Tax Bills Across Baird, Callahan County, Texas
How are property tax bills calculated in Baird, Texas?
Property tax bills in Baird are based on the assessed value of a home and the tax rates set by local taxing authorities. The assessed value is influenced by the market value of the property, and homeowners are taxed on that amount rather than the purchase price. In Callahan County, the median home price is $95,375, which helps show the local tax base used to determine bills.
What factors affect the final bill? Local tax rates, exemptions, and the assessed value all play a role. For many homeowners, the 25th percentile tax bill is $631, while the 75th percentile tax bill is $2,513 and the 90th percentile tax bill is $4,068. That range shows how much property taxes can vary from one home to another.
How does this affect homeowners? A higher assessed value or fewer exemptions can lead to a larger bill, making property taxes a meaningful part of annual housing costs.
